Spread Structure (5 Cards)

Card 1 — How leadership truly sees you

Not what they say about you — but the internal label they've assigned. This card reveals whether you're viewed as leadership material, a reliable executor, a stabilizer, a problem-solver, or someone whose value lies in not rocking the boat. This sets the ceiling unless actively challenged.

Card 2 — What you're being valued for (and exploited for)

This card exposes the function you currently serve in the system. Sometimes it's skill. Sometimes it's emotional labor. Sometimes it's availability, compliance, or crisis absorption. If this card shows high output with low authority, promotion risk is already visible.

Card 3 — The politics you're not seeing

Every promotion is political. This card shows the forces operating around you: competing candidates, budget freezes disguised as optimism, gatekeepers you're not speaking to, power struggles unrelated to your performance. This is where most people misread the situation — and overestimate fairness.

Card 4 — What you must demonstrate to get the "yes"

This is not about working harder. It shows the specific signal leadership needs before approving movement: authority, detachment, external validation, boundary-setting, scarcity. If this card contradicts how you've been behaving — that's the problem.

Card 5 — Timeline + best negotiation angle

When does movement become possible? How do you approach the conversation without weakening your position? This card distinguishes between strategic waiting, leverage-building, and knowing when silence is no longer smart. This is where clarity turns into action.
